Transaction 5c7fa676292c1936f0a858e260646154251946c669c89a407db81f8a7d831655

1 Input
1 Outputs
  • 5c7fa676292c1936f0a858e260646154251946c669c89a407db81f8a7d831655:0
  • value  23893781
    address  3KewvLScKqMHDpk8aJxrvdVtPfs2gMxHRX